题
我试图用tweepy API,使Twitter的功能,我有两个问题。 我有与一般的终端和Python缺乏经验。
1)它与Python 2.6正确安装,但是我不能使用它或与Python 3.1安装它。当我尝试安装模块3.1它给了我一个错误,没有模块setuptools的。本来我想也许我无法使用tweepy模块3.1,但是在自述它说:“Python的3支(3.1)”,我假设意味着它是兼容的。当我搜索的setuptools的模块,我想我可以加载到新版本中,只有最多的Python 2.7模块。我怎么会在Python 3.1中,正确地安装Tweepy API?
2)我的默认Python从终端中运行时是2.6.1,我想使它3.1所以不必须键入python3.1。
解决方案
安装分发其是不支持的Python 3.做当setuptools的的兼容叉所以,请确保您使用Python 3而不是Python的2。大多数Python 3个的安装提供了一个名为python3
symlimk或命令,而python
指的是一个Python 2安装。因为Python 2和Python 3之间的不兼容的差异,建议您不要试图取代它并有python
指python3
。
其他提示
<强>更新强>中的注释如下具有针对该技术的一些固体分。
2)什么操作系统,你运行?通常,有一个符号链接某处在系统中,从该点“蟒”到“ pythonx.x ”,其中x.x代表由操作系统优选的版本号。在Linux中,有一个符号链接的的/ usr /斌/蟒,其指向(在Ubuntu 10.04)的 /usr/bin/python2.6 上的标准安装。
只需手动当前链接点改变到python3.1二进制,和你的罚款。
不隶属于 StackOverflow